Устройство не определяется после удаления драйвера: что делать

Если после удаления драйвера устройство перестало отображаться в системе, первым делом выполните принудительное сканирование конфигурации оборудования через Диспетчер устройств. Эта процедура заставляет операционную систему заново опросить все физические порты и шины данных для обнаружения компонентов, оставшихся без программного обеспечения. В случае неудачи необходимо полностью обесточить компьютер и переподключить устройство в другой порт, чтобы сбросить состояние контроллера и инициализировать процесс Plug and Play.

Диагностика состояния оборудования и поиск скрытых конфликтов

Когда драйвер удаляется некорректно или через сторонние утилиты, в реестре Windows могут остаться «фантомные» записи, которые блокируют повторное обнаружение устройства. Система считает, что компонент всё еще управляется старым процессом, хотя файлы драйвера фактически отсутствуют. Это приводит к тому, что устройство не появляется в списке активных, но при этом занимает ресурсы прерываний или адресное пространство памяти.

Типичные симптомы программной невидимости включают отсутствие реакции системы на физическое подключение кабеля, отсутствие звуковых сигналов Windows при вставке USB-устройств и пустые ветки в дереве оборудования. В некоторых случаях устройство может отображаться в разделе «Контроллеры USB» или «Системные устройства» как «Неизвестное USB-устройство (сбой запроса дескриптора устройства)» с кодом ошибки 43 или 10.

Для глубокой диагностики необходимо проверить наличие устройства в скрытом режиме. В Диспетчере устройств перейдите в меню «Вид» и выберите пункт «Показать скрытые устройства». Если после этого в списке появились полупрозрачные иконки, это означает, что система хранит информацию о старых привязках драйверов, которые конфликтуют с новой установкой. Такие записи подлежат удалению перед повторной попыткой инсталляции ПО.

Перед выполнением любых манипуляций с системными реестрами или удалением драйверов создайте точку восстановления системы. Это позволит вернуть ОС в рабочее состояние, если действия приведут к отказу критически важных служб или интерфейсов ввода-вывода.

Быстрое решение: принудительное обновление конфигурации

Самый эффективный способ вернуть устройство в поле зрения операционной системы — запуск штатного мастера сканирования шин. Это помогает в 60% случаев, когда проблема ограничена программным сбоем службы Plug and Play.

  1. Нажмите сочетание клавиш Win + R, введите devmgmt.msc и нажмите Enter.
  2. В открывшемся окне выделите левой кнопкой мыши верхнюю строку с именем вашего компьютера.
  3. Перейдите в верхнее меню «Действие» и выберите пункт «Обновить конфигурацию оборудования».
  4. Дождитесь завершения процесса, во время которого экран может несколько раз мигнуть, а список устройств — обновиться.

Если устройство исправно, Windows обнаружит его и попытается установить стандартный драйвер из локального хранилища DriverStore. Если автоматическая установка не началась, проверьте раздел «Другие устройства», где должен появиться пункт с желтым восклицательным знаком.

Основной метод: идентификация по аппаратному ИД и ручная инъекция драйвера

Если автоматика не справляется, необходимо вручную указать системе, какой именно драйвер соответствует неопознанному компоненту. Для этого используются уникальные идентификаторы производителя (VEN или VID) и самого устройства (DEV или PID).

Поиск аппаратного идентификатора

Найдите в Диспетчере устройств пункт «Неизвестное устройство» или любой узел с ошибкой. Нажмите на него правой кнопкой мыши и выберите «Свойства». На вкладке «Сведения» в выпадающем списке параметров найдите «ИД оборудования». Вы увидите строки, содержащие комбинации символов, например, PCIVEN_8086&DEV_15E3. Эти данные являются «паспортом» устройства, который не меняется даже при полном удалении программного обеспечения.

Загрузка и установка подходящего ПО

Используя полученный ИД, скачайте драйвер с официального сайта производителя чипсета (например, Intel, AMD, Realtek или NVIDIA). Избегайте использования автоматических установщиков-сборников, так как они часто подменяют оригинальные .inf файлы универсальными заглушками, что и приводит к исчезновению устройств из системы.

  1. Распакуйте скачанный архив с драйвером в отдельную папку (должны появиться файлы с расширением .sys, .inf, .cat).
  2. В Диспетчере устройств нажмите правой кнопкой на неизвестном компоненте и выберите «Обновить драйвер».
  3. Выберите вариант «Найти драйверы на этом компьютере».
  4. Нажмите «Обзор» и укажите путь к папке с распакованными файлами.
  5. Если система сообщает, что подходящие драйверы не найдены, выберите опцию «Выбрать драйвер из списка доступных драйверов на компьютере», нажмите «Установить с диска» и вручную укажите путь к конкретному .inf файлу.

Альтернативный метод: очистка реестра от блокирующих фильтров

Существуют ситуации, когда устройство не определяется из-за поврежденных параметров UpperFilters и LowerFilters в реестре Windows. Эти параметры часто создаются антивирусами, эмуляторами дисков или программами для записи CD/DVD. После удаления основного драйвера эти записи остаются «висеть» в системе, блокируя стандартный стек протоколов.

Для исправления этой ошибки откройте редактор реестра (regedit) и перейдите в раздел H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lClass. Здесь расположены подразделы, соответствующие классам устройств (например, {4d36e965-e325-11ce-bfc1-08002be10318} для оптических приводов или {71a27cdd-812a-11d0-bec7-08002be2092f} для томов дисков). Найдите класс вашего устройства и удалите в правой панели ключи UpperFilters и LowerFilters, если они там присутствуют. После перезагрузки система заново инициализирует стандартные драйверы без учета удаленного ПО.

Устранение проблем на уровне питания и BIOS/UEFI

Иногда удаление драйвера совпадает с переходом контроллера в режим энергосбережения, из которого он не может выйти без «холодной» перезагрузки. Это особенно актуально для USB-хабов, сетевых адаптеров Wi-Fi и дискретных звуковых карт.

Сброс статического заряда

Выключите компьютер и полностью отсоедините его от сети 220V. Если это ноутбук, извлеките аккумулятор (если он съемный). Нажмите и удерживайте кнопку включения в течение 30-40 секунд. Это действие разрядит конденсаторы на материнской плате и сбросит временную память контроллеров, что часто заставляет систему заново увидеть «пропавшее» оборудование при следующем запуске.

Настройки интерфейса в BIOS

Проверьте настройки BIOS/UEFI. В разделах Integrated Peripherals или Onboard Devices Configuration убедитесь, что соответствующий контроллер (USB, Audio, LAN) находится в состоянии Enabled. Иногда при программных сбоях в Windows настройки BIOS могут быть интерпретированы неверно, и переключение параметра в Disabled, сохранение, а затем возврат в Enabled помогает восстановить видимость устройства.

Восстановление хранилища драйверов DriverStore

Если после удаления драйвера система выдает ошибку при попытке установить даже стандартное ПО, возможно, повреждено системное хранилище DriverStore. Windows использует его как базу эталонных драйверов. Для восстановления целостности воспользуйтесь командной строкой с правами администратора.

Выполните команду dism /online /cleanup-image /restorehealth. Эта операция проверит системные файлы на соответствие официальному образу Microsoft и загрузит недостающие компоненты. После этого выполните команду sfc /scannow, которая исправит ошибки в локальных библиотеках, отвечающих за работу Plug and Play менеджера. По завершении процедур перезагрузите ПК и повторите поиск оборудования в Диспетчере устройств.

Профилактика повторных сбоев оборудования

Чтобы минимизировать риск исчезновения устройств при обновлении ПО, всегда удаляйте старые драйверы через «Программы и компоненты» панели управления или специализированную оснастку производителя, а не простым удалением файлов из папки System32. При использовании утилит вроде DDU (Display Driver Uninstaller) всегда выбирайте режим удаления с последующей перезагрузкой.

  • Не используйте агрессивные чистильщики реестра в автоматическом режиме.
  • Перед обновлением прошивок (Firmware) или драйверов чипсета убедитесь, что в системе нет незавершенных обновлений Windows.
  • Храните копии критически важных драйверов (сетевой адаптер, контроллер дисков) на внешнем носителе.
  • Отключите функцию «Быстрый запуск» в настройках электропитания Windows, так как она часто препятствует полной инициализации оборудования при включении ПК.


Добавить комментарий